Man Charged with Attempted Murder After Tilbury Attack Leaves Two Women Injured
A 29-year-old man from Greenwich has been charged with attempted murder following a violent incident in Tilbury that left two women hurt.
Violent Morning in Windrush Road
Police were called to Windrush Road at around 9.35am on Sunday 12 July after reports of a collision involving a woman and a vehicle. The woman sustained serious injuries. Another woman was also assaulted during the incident.
Suspect Arrested and Charged
The man was arrested at the scene and now faces multiple charges: attempted murder, causing serious injury by dangerous driving, assault occasioning actual bodily harm (ABH), failing to provide a specimen, and driving without a proper licence.
Suspect to Appear in Court
He is due to appear at Chelmsford Magistrates’ Court on Tuesday 14 July.
Police Reassure Community
Chief Inspector Richard Melton, District Commander for Thurrock, said: “This charge is the result of some really hard work over the last 24 hours. I know this will be a concerning incident to people living and working in Tilbury but we do not believe there is a risk to the wider public.”
